Summary

Odafe Oweh, a linebacker for the Washington Commanders, recounted how his football career started after he was removed from his high school basketball team. Transitioning to football at age 16, Oweh quickly garnered attention from college scouts, eventually being drafted in the first round of the 2021 NFL Draft. He signed a four-year, $100 million contract with the Commanders this spring after playing his first four seasons with the Baltimore Ravens. Training camp performance has impressed the coaching staff, highlighting his potential impact on the team in the upcoming season.
